A search for moment localisation in UMn2
Authors:R Cywinski  S H Kilcoyne  T Holubar  G Hilscher
Institution:(1) J J Thomson Physical Laboratory, University of Reading, RG6 2AF Reading, UK;(2) Institut fur Experimentalphysik, Technische Universitat Wien, A-1040 Wien, Austria;(3) Present address: Rutherford Appleton Laboratory, OX11 0QX Chilton, UK
Abstract:mgrSR, high resolution neutron powder diffraction and heat capacity have been used to study the spin fluctuation compound UMn2. The mgrSR spectra are dominated by muon depolarisation due to static fields from the Mn nuclei, features in the temperature dependence of the associated relaxation rate, sgr, correlating well with the structural transitions observed at 210K. While a weak exponential relaxation (lambda sim 0.01mgrs–1) indicates the presence of atomic spin fluctuations between 50K and 325K, mgrSR provides little evidence of moment localisation or long range magnetic order, although an anomalous increase in sgr below 40K is observed.
